Transaction 51d87ada740fe08059d75f13caa281143ebfe2cc62e9893294bb28840532fed2

1 Input
2 Outputs
  • 51d87ada740fe08059d75f13caa281143ebfe2cc62e9893294bb28840532fed2:0
  • value  139346
    address  12gN9C5RH7GFQZrypRfDVHEmQzJheGWzGw
  • 51d87ada740fe08059d75f13caa281143ebfe2cc62e9893294bb28840532fed2:1
  • value  16405445
    address  344DFTGBYBiumkdecKMzyY2STNRKMpHrd6